So, ...Maybe This Time is an interesting exploration of relationships and self-discovery. Directed by Chris McGill, it captures a certain melancholy vibe as Fran, played by a compelling lead, navigates her thirties and the chaos of love. The pacing feels unhurried, almost reflective, which fits the small-town setting beautifully. You get that sense of longing, the weight of choices in her affairs—first with Stephen, then Alan, and even her complicated dynamic with Paddy. The performances are quite strong, with an authentic feel that draws you into Fran's dilemmas. It's not flashy, but the emotional texture sticks with you, showcasing the nuances of romance and regret. Definitely a film that lingers long after the credits roll.
